
Keisuke and Shizuko grew up by the Kitakami river and came to fall in love before they knew it. Eighteen years ago, Shizuko was left an orphan and was taken in by Keisuke's parents, who had raised her as their own child. At the riverside when the cherry blossoms are falling, Keisuke, now enrolled in university, promises Shizuko that he will tell his parents about them at the start of the summer vacation. He then sets off for Tokyo...

The original title is "北上夜曲" (JA).
The runtime is 62 minutes (1h 2m).
The film was directed by Yoshitsugu Nakajima.
The screenplay was written by Gan Yamazaki and Ryuma Takemori.
The score was composed by Seiichi Mawatari.
Cinematography was handled by Izumi Hagiwara.
